区块链的智能合约指的是什么币圈家园
区块链的智能合约指的是什么
近年来,随着区块链技术的发展和广泛应用,智能合约成为了人们热议的话题之一。那么,究竟什么是区块链的智能合约呢?
区块链是一种分布式账本技术,它以去中心化、安全可信的方式记录和验证交易数据,具有不可篡改、可追溯的特点。而智能合约则是在区块链上运行的程序代码,可以自动执行特定的条件和操作。
智能合约的概念最早由比特币之父中本聪提出,他认为通过将合约逻辑编码到区块链上,可以实现自动化执行和去信任的交易过程。后来,以太坊等平台推出了更加通用和灵活的智能合约功能,进一步促进了区块链技术的发展。
智能合约可以理解为一种先进的计算机程序,它在特定条件满足时自动触发,并根据预先设定的规则进行操作。这些规则可以包括用户的身份验证、交易的授权、资金的转移等等。智能合约的执行结果被永久记录在区块链上,不可篡改和删除。
智能合约具有以下几个重要特点:
1. 自动化执行:智能合约能够自动触发,并根据预先设定的条件执行相应的操作,消除了人为干预和中介机构的需求,提高了交易效率。
2. 去信任验证:由于智能合约是在分布式的区块链上执行,每个参与者都可以验证合约执行的结果,无需依赖中心化机构的认证。这种去信任的特性使得交易更加可靠和安全。
3. 不可篡改性:智能合约的执行结果被记录在区块链上,不可篡改和删除。这就意味着合约一旦触发,相关的交易和操作将永久保存,确保了合约的可追溯性和透明度。
4. 多方协作:智能合约可以实现多个参与方之间的协作和交互,通过在合约中设置相应的权限和规则,确保所有参与方的利益得到平等保护。
然而,智能合约也存在一些挑战和风险。首先,智能合约的编写需要具备一定的技术能力和安全意识,否则可能导致合约漏洞或被攻击。其次,由于合约一旦执行将不可逆转,因此需要仔细考虑和测试合约的逻辑和条件,以避免出现无法预料的问题。
尽管如此,智能合约在金融、物流、供应链等诸多领域都具有巨大的潜力和应用前景。通过智能合约,可以实现更加高效、安全和可信的交易和业务流程,进一步推动区块链技术的发展和创新。
总之,区块链的智能合约是在分布式账本上运行的程序代码,能够自动执行特定条件下的操作,并且具备自动化执行、去信任验证、不可篡改性和多方协作等特点。尽管面临一些挑战,但其潜力和应用前景不容小觑。我们有理由相信,随着区块链技术的不断发展,智能合约将在未来产生更为广泛和深远的影响。
本文由某某资讯网发布,不代表某某资讯网立场,转载联系作者并注明出处:https://biquanjiayuan.com/redian/1676.html